温馨提示×

温馨提示×

您好,登录后才能下订单哦!

密码登录×
登录注册×
其他方式登录
点击 登录注册 即表示同意《亿速云用户服务条款》

Oracle Value函数与事务管理的融合

发布时间:2024-10-08 18:03:12 来源:亿速云 阅读:82 作者:小樊 栏目:关系型数据库

Oracle Value函数与事务管理的融合主要涉及到在事务处理过程中如何获取和处理数据值。这种融合可以确保在事务的各个阶段都能够准确地获取到所需的数据,并且保证数据的一致性和完整性。

Oracle Value函数是一种用于获取数据值的函数,它可以从一个或多个表中提取数据,并根据指定的条件进行过滤和转换。在事务管理中,Oracle Value函数可以被用来获取事务开始时的数据状态,以及在事务执行过程中需要使用的其他关键数据。

为了实现Oracle Value函数与事务管理的融合,需要考虑以下几个方面:

  1. 事务隔离级别:根据事务的隔离级别,确定哪些数据需要在事务开始时被锁定,以确保数据的一致性。例如,在读已提交(Read Committed)隔离级别下,只需要锁定被修改的数据行;而在可重复读(Repeatable Read)或串行化(Serializable)隔离级别下,可能需要锁定整个表或行。
  2. 锁管理:在事务处理过程中,需要合理地管理锁,以避免死锁和其他并发问题。Oracle Value函数可以在获取数据时自动获取适当的锁,以确保事务的顺利进行。
  3. 数据验证:在事务执行过程中,需要对获取的数据进行验证,以确保数据的准确性和完整性。Oracle Value函数可以与其他函数和过程结合使用,以实现对数据的复杂验证。
  4. 异常处理:在事务处理过程中,可能会遇到各种异常情况,如网络故障、数据库崩溃等。需要设计合理的异常处理机制,以确保在发生异常时能够正确地回滚事务,并释放锁和资源。

总之,Oracle Value函数与事务管理的融合需要综合考虑多个方面,包括事务隔离级别、锁管理、数据验证和异常处理等。通过合理地设计和实现这些机制,可以确保在事务处理过程中能够准确地获取和处理数据值,并保持数据的一致性和完整性。

向AI问一下细节

免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:is@yisu.com进行举报,并提供相关证据,一经查实,将立刻删除涉嫌侵权内容。

AI